I think Cassidy and Nyx are my favorites so far. Their stories are the most interesting at this point.

Cassidy has escaped her captor and managed to hide away on the Zivonian ship. She decides to hide out in a smaller ship on board to avoid any interaction with the aliens on board.

After being denied by the commander, Nyx decides to take it upon himself to go in search of his missing brother so he steals a smaller ship in the middle of the night. Days later he finds his terran stowaway and their adventure begins. 

Unlike the other women in the series, Cassidy was not lucky enough to avoid being trafficked and sold into slavery. So she is working through a lot of trauma regarding intimacy. And Nyx is a wonderful Consent King👑❤️.
